33,532,622 is a composite number, even.
33,532,622 (thirty-three million five hundred thirty-two thousand six hundred twenty-two) is an even 8-digit number. It is a composite number with 8 divisors, and factors as 2 × 881 × 19,031. Written other ways, in hexadecimal, 0x1FFAACE.
